  4. Feb 23, 2009 · In one of the examples for calculating the 21 days clear notice, it was given as follows: Date of AGM 07.09.2005. Date of despatch of notice 16.08.2005. 16.8.05 to 7.9.05 23 days. Less date of servie and meeting: 2 days = 21 days. Less: Transit time : 48 hours i.e. 2 days = 19 days. Thus there is a shortage of two days.

  5. Sep 19, 2014 · As provided in section 101, an advance notice of not less than 21 days shall be given for calling a general meeting of members. The requirement of 21 days means 21 clear days, exclusive of the day when notice is served and the day when the meeting is held.
